Written Answers. - Training for Fishing Industry.

20.

(Donegal South-West) asked the Minister for Fisheries and Forestry if he is satisfied with the level of training and education for young persons who are anxious to join the fishing industry; and the steps he is taking to improve the position.

Young persons anxious to join the fishing industry can avail of the training and education facilities provided by An Bord Iascaigh Mhara. The board also provide facilities for the training of experienced fishermen as skippers at the National Fishery School in Greencastle and at local centres with the aid of the mobile training unit. I am fully satisfied with the board's training and education programme.
